Application and performance of crankshaft forgings in locomotive

Crankshaft forging is a key component in locomotive power system, its application and performance play an important role in the running stability and reliability of locomotive. This paper will discuss the application of crankshaft forgings in locomotive and its performance.

The crankshaft forging is the core part of the locomotive power system, which mainly undertakes the task of transforming the reciprocating motion of the piston into rotating motion. In a diesel engine, the crankshaft forgings convert the reciprocating motion of the piston into its own rotating motion through the connecting rod, thus driving the locomotive forward. At the same time, the crankshaft forging also bears the important responsibility of output torque and bearing load, which is the key factor to ensure the normal operation of the locomotive.

Mechanical performance of crankshaft forgings

Strength and toughness: Crankshaft forgings need to withstand the huge torque and impact force from diesel engines, so they must have high strength and toughness. High quality crankshaft forgings can effectively resist mechanical stress, prevent breakage and deformation, and thus ensure the normal operation of the locomotive.
Wear resistance: Crankshaft forgings have friction with connecting rod, bearing and other components during operation, so they need to have good wear resistance. Crankshaft forgings with good wear resistance can extend their service life, reduce the frequency of maintenance and replacement, and reduce operating costs.
Fatigue strength: crankshaft forgings in the long-term operation process, will be subject to periodic load action, easy to produce fatigue cracks. Therefore, the crankshaft forgings must have high fatigue strength to resist fatigue cracks and ensure the safe operation of the locomotive.

In order to meet the above performance requirements, the choice of crankshaft forging materials is very important. Commonly used crankshaft forging materials include carbon steel, alloy steel and so on. These materials have the characteristics of high strength, high toughness, good wear resistance and fatigue resistance, which can meet the application requirements of crankshaft forgings in locomotives.
